## Display and Design
The display is one of the most critical aspects of a smartphone. A good display can make all the difference in your viewing experience. Here are some key factors to consider:
* **Screen size**: Measure your needs against the available screen sizes. Larger screens are ideal for gaming, video streaming, and multitasking, but may be less comfortable to hold and use.
* **Resolution**: Look for a phone with a high-resolution display (at least Full HD) for crisp and vibrant visuals.
* **Refresh rate**: A higher refresh rate (at least 90Hz) can provide a smoother and more responsive experience.
* **Design**: Consider a phone with a durable design, water resistance, and a comfortable grip.
## Performance and Power
A smartphone’s performance and power are crucial for a seamless experience. Here are some key factors to consider:
* **Processor**: Look for a phone with a fast processor (at least quad-core) and a sufficient clock speed (at least 2.5 GHz) for smooth performance.
* **RAM**: Ensure the phone has enough RAM (at least 6 GB) to handle demanding tasks and multitasking.
* **Storage**: Consider a phone with expandable storage (at least 128 GB) for storing your files, photos, and apps.

## Battery Life and Charging
A smartphone’s battery life and charging capabilities are crucial for a hassle-free experience. Here are some key factors to consider:
* **Battery life**: Look for a phone with a long-lasting battery (at least 12 hours) for extended use.
* **Charging speed**: Ensure the phone supports fast charging (at least Quick Charge 3.0) for quick top-ups.
* **Wireless charging**: Consider a phone with wireless charging capabilities for added convenience.

## Additional Features
A smartphone’s additional features can enhance your overall experience. Here are some key factors to consider:
* **Water resistance**: Look for a phone with IP68 or higher rating for water and dust resistance.
* **Wireless connectivity**: Ensure the phone supports 5G and Wi-Fi 6 for fast and reliable connectivity.
* **Audio quality**: Consider a phone with advanced audio features like Hi-Fi audio, Dolby Atmos, and 3D audio.

### What is the difference between a 5G and 4G smartphone?
A 5G smartphone offers faster data speeds, lower latency, and improved connectivity. If you live in an area with 5G coverage and plan to use your phone for data-intensive activities, a 5G smartphone may be the better choice. However, if you’re on a budget or don’t have 5G coverage in your area, a 4G smartphone may be sufficient.
